CBSE Class 12 Result 2025: Pass Percentage at 88.39%

The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E) has announced the Class 12 exam results for 2025, showing a marginal increase in the pass percentage. This year, 88.39% of candidates cleared the exams, up slightly from 87.98% in 2024. Among the successful candidates, 91.64% of girls passed, outpacing the boys, of whom 85.70% passed. Transgender candidates saw an impressive 100% pass rate, a remarkable jump from last year’s 50%.

Top Performers and Special Achievements

A total of 1,11,544 students scored above 90%, and 24,867 candidates scored above 95% this year. These numbers indicate a slight decrease compared to last year’s performance, where 1.16 lakh students scored above 90%, and 24,068 students scored above 95%. 290 children with special needs scored above 90%, and 55 of them achieved more than 95%, highlighting the increased opportunities for inclusive education.

Regional and Institutional Performance Insights

The Vijaywada region emerged as the top performer with a pass percentage of 99.60%, followed closely by Trivandrum at 99.32%. On the other hand, Prayagraj reported the lowest pass percentage at 79.53%. Jawahar Navodaya Vidyalayas (JNVs) maintained their excellence, with a 99.9% pass rate, while private schools recorded a lower pass percentage of 87.94%. The number of students needing to appear for compartment exams increased slightly, with 1.29 lakh students placed in this category compared to 1.22 lakh last year.
